10. | James Stewart, Regent of Scotland First Earl of Moray was born about 1531 in East Lothian, Scotland (son of King James Stewart, V of Scotland and Margaret Erskine); died on 21 Jan 1595/96 in Linlithgow, West Lothian, Linlithgowshire, Scotland. Other Events and Attributes:
Notes: Born c. 1531 and murdered 1570. Moray, born James Stewart, was the illegitimate half-brother of Mary Queen of Scots. Moray was a ruthless, and clever politician who always seemed to be in the right place at the right time. Ambitious and power-hungry, he was the most powerful nobleman of his age. He played a major part in driving Mary from Scotland. [2, 3]** James married Anna Agnes Keith, Countess of Moray. Notes: Agnes Keith,Countess of Moray, Regent of Scotland and at one time most powerful woman in Scotland, daughter of William Keith 3rd or 4th "Earl of Marishal" of Dunnottar Castle. She married James Stuart 1st Earl of Moray regent of Scotland 1567-1570, illegitimate son of King James and half brother of Mary Queen of Scots.
